Carrollton's red clay presents a real challenge for natural grass, especially with pets in the mix. That clay compacts easily and holds moisture, which means your yard stays soggy longer after rain and becomes a slip-and-slide hazard when wet. When dogs dig or dig and play on saturated clay, you're looking at torn-up patches that take forever to recover. Artificial pet turf solves this by providing excellent drainage—water moves right through the backing and into a proper base layer, so your yard stays usable even after heavy rain.
